1 day
Durée
On-site or remote
Modalités
50%
Pratique
Aperçu
À propos de ce cours
Description
A one-day introductory workshop evaluating Rust's relevance for your software development projects. Combines theoretical instruction with practical evaluation to help you decide whether Rust suits your organizational needs.
À qui s'adresse cette formation ?
You are considering adopting Rust and need to assess its advantages and trade-offs for your specific projects before committing.
CTOs and technical decision-makersProject managers and architectsStartup foundersDevelopers
Objectifs
Ce que vous allez apprendre
01
Understand Rust's key language characteristics
02
Evaluate advantages and disadvantages for concrete projects
03
Assess adoption feasibility for your team
Programme
Plan de la formation
01
Rust Fundamentals
- —Language history and inspirations
- —Core design principles
02
Core Features
- —Functional programming and static typing
- —Polymorphism and linear typing
- —Ownership model
03
Ecosystem & Environment
- —Performance and language comparisons
- —Tooling and formal methods
04
Evaluation Workshop
- —Analysis of a real project
- —Expected gains and anticipated challenges
- —Decision synthesis
Infos pratiques
Avant de vous inscrire
Prérequis
- —Software engineering knowledge
- —Programming experience in any language
Format
- On-site or remote
- 3–10 participants
- 50% exercices pratiques
- Horaires : 9h30 - 17h30
Financement
- Certifié Qualiopi
- Éligible OPCO
- Sessions sur demande sous 2 mois
- Accessibilité PMR et adaptations possibles
Instructeurs
Vos formateurs
Arthur Carcano
R&D developer with 5+ years professional Rust experience.
Fabrice Le Fessant
INRIA researcher, OCamlPro founder, multi-language expert.
S'inscrire